... View MoreYou can't really rate this show more than 5. It's very superficial, but it's watchable, in other words, if you are bored enough, you could chain-watch several episodes and be fulfilled, on a very primal level. There is a lot of TNA, which although mentally degrading, will allure a large male fan base. Molly Simms, whom prior I didn't care for (seeing as she was, seemingly, just a hot blonde airhead) actually puts in a pretty good performance, but the real jewel in the cast is James Lesure, who plays Mike Cannon, and steals every scene he's in. Josh Duhamel, who plays Danny, is a rather palid, one-dimensional actor, with a performance to boot, and James Caan is James Caan. The show isn't particularly funny, or suspenseful, but it's light and it's easy.
